Fungsi IddCxAdapterDisplayConfigUpdate (iddcx.h)
Driver jarak jauh dapat memanggil IddCxAdapterDisplayConfigUpdate untuk memungkinkan klien memberi tahu server cara memperbarui konfigurasi monitor. Driver yang melaporkan dukungan HDR harus menggunakan IddCxAdapterDisplayConfigUpdate2 sebagai gantinya.
Sintaks
NTSTATUS IddCxAdapterDisplayConfigUpdate(
IDDCX_ADAPTER AdapterObject,
const IDARG_IN_ADAPTERDISPLAYCONFIGUPDATE *pInArgs
);
Parameter
AdapterObject
[in] Objek IDDCX_ADAPTER adaptor jarak jauh yang konfigurasi tampilannya ditentukan.
pInArgs
[in] Penunjuk ke struktur IDARG_IN_ADAPTERDISPLAYCONFIGUPDATE yang berisi argumen input ke fungsi.
Nilai kembali
IddCxAdapterDisplayConfigUpdate mengembalikan STATUS_SUCCESS setelah berhasil; jika tidak, kode kesalahan akan menampilkan kode kesalahan yang sesuai. Lihat Keterangan.
Keterangan
Driver tampilan tidak langsung jarak jauh (IDD) memanggil IddCxAdapterDisplayConfigUpdate saat menerima konfigurasi tampilan baru.
OS mengembalikan STATUS_SUCCESS jika telah menyimpan konfigurasi tampilan yang baru ditentukan. Perubahan ini akan secara asinkron mengonfigurasi ulang swapchain untuk monitor seperti yang diminta. IddCxAdapterDisplayConfigUpdate akan terlebih dahulu membersihkan kedatangan monitor yang tertunda, dan memproses keberangkatan untuk memastikan bahwa daftar monitor saat ini.
Jika IddCxAdapterDisplayConfigUpdate menentukan bahwa konfigurasi tampilan yang disediakan saat ini tidak didukung oleh driver, iddCxAdapterDisplayConfigUpdate menentukan bahwa konfigurasi tampilan yang disediakan saat ini tidak didukung oleh driver, ia mengembalikan STATUS_INVALID_PARAMETER dan mencatat alasan menggunakan WPP untuk tujuan penelusuran kesalahan. Misalnya, driver mungkin tidak mendukung resolusi/laju refresh tertentu, atau monitor yang tidak valid mungkin ditentukan.
IddCxAdapterDisplayConfigUpdate mengembalikan STATUS_GRAPHICS_INDIRECT_DISPLAY_DEVICE_STOPPED jika sesi perubahan konfigurasi ini ditargetkan untuk terputus atau jika adaptor sesi dihentikan.
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ung | Windows 10, versi 1903 |
Header | iddcx.h |